There are 25% as many blue balls as green balls in Kathy's collection of balls. The number of black balls is 45% fewer than the number of green balls. There are 384 more black balls than blue balls.
- Find the total number of balls in the collection.
- What percentage are the number of green balls as compared to the number of black balls? Leave your answer as a mixed number in its simplest form.

1120 The number of green balls is the repeated identity. Make the number of green balls the same. LCM of 4 and 20 is 20.
Number of more black balls than blue balls
= 11 u - 5 u
= 6 u
6 u = 384
1 u = 384 ÷ 6 = 64
Total number of balls in the collection
= 5 u + 20 u + 11 u
= 36 u
= 36 x 64
= 2304
